The surface area of a cube is 6 times the square of the side length. If we call the side length of the cube s:

6s^2=2400 \\\\s^2=400 \\\\s=20

Since the volume of a cube is the side length cubed, the volume of this is 20^3=8000\text{ cm}^3.

<h3>What is a linear function?</h3>

A linear function is modeled by:

y = mx + b

In which:

  • m is the slope, which is the rate of change, that is, by how much y changes when x changes by 1.
  • b is the y-intercept, which is the value of y when x = 0.

In this problem, the function is given by:

C = 200 + 0.8Y.

Which means that the slope is of m = 0.8 per unit of Y.

For 1000 units:

0.8 x 1000 = 800.

Consumption would increase by $800.
